1. Regulations on management and use of finance and assets of vocational education institutions in Vietnam

Regulations on management and use of finance and assets of vocational education institutions in Vietnam according to Article 31 of the Law on Vocational Education 2014 are as follows:

- The vocational education institution shall follow finance, accounting, auditing, taxation regime and financial disclosure as prescribed.

- The vocational education institution using government budget must manage and use the government budget resources as prescribed in law on government budget.

The public vocational education institution may decide the capital mobilization, use of capital and assets associated with the tasks assigned to expand and improve the quality of training as prescribed in regulations of the Heads of vocational education authorities in the central government.

- The vocational education institution manages and uses the assets from government budget as prescribed in law on management and use of state-owned property; enjoy autonomy and take responsibility for management and use of the assets from the government budget.

- The assets and land allocated to the private vocational education institution by the State under form of sponsorship, aid, or gift must be used for proper purposes and they are not changed into private ownership regardless of forms.

- The vocational education authorities in the central government, Ministries, ministerial-level agencies, and the People’s Committee of the province shall inspect the management and use of the finance resources at the vocational education institutions; management and use of state-owned property of the vocational education institutions as prescribed in regulations of the Government.

2. Policies on vocational education institutions in Vietnam

Policies on vocational education institutions in Vietnam according to Article 26 of the Law on Vocational Education 2014 are as follows:

- The vocational education institution shall benefit from the following policies:

+ Acquire land through land allocation or lease by the State; receive incentives for credit to invest in facilities and improve the training quality; tax incentives in accordance with regulations of law on taxation; tax exemption from the undivided income in the vocational education to invest in development; tax exemption and reduction as prescribed in regulations on profits earned from products or services of the training activities; tax incentives applied to the production, business or services conformable with the training activities, publishing of teaching materials, production and provision of training equipment, import of books, newspaper, materials and training equipment;

+ Participate in tender, receive the training order of the State as prescribed in law on tender, orders for public services using government budget.

+ Apply for capital incentives from domestic and foreign programs or projects;

+ Participate in programs for training of domestic and foreign vocational educators or administrative officials using the funding from the government budget;

+ Support the investment to ensure the requirements in order to accept upper-secondary ethnic boarding school graduates to apprentice;

+ Support development in training of disciplines meeting study demands of the workers working abroad;

+ Incentive policies on private sector involvement as prescribed.

- People’s Committees at all levels shall enable vocational education institutions in the administrative divisions to undertake training activities, propagate the progress of science, technology and technology transfers.
